This book quantifies the potential for greater energy efficiency in industry on the basis of technology- and sector-related analyses.

Starting from the methodological fundamentals, the first part discusses the electricity- and heat-based basic technologies and cross-sectional processes on the basis of numerous application examples.

In addition to classic topics such as lighting and heat recovery, the study also covers processes that have received less attention to date, such as drying and painting.

The second part is devoted to energy-intensive industries, in particular metal production and processing, the manufacture of the non-metallic materials cement and glass, and the chemical, paper, plastics and food industries.

Both parts are concluded by placing them in a larger energy and economic context.

The findings are condensed into checklists at many points and summarized in the overall view at the end to form generally applicable recommendations. This book is a translation ofthe original German 2nd edition Energieeffizienz in der Industrie by Markus Blesl and Alois Kessler, published by Springer-Verlag GmbH Germany, part of Springer Nature in 2017.

The translation was done with the help of artificial intelligence (machine translation by the service DeepL.com).

A subsequent human revision was done primarily in terms of content, so that the book will read stylistically differently from a conventional translation.
